SALF's Homeland Security Press ConferenceSubtitleReturn to the Press Release Index In conjunction with the Illinois Municipal League’s Board of Directors Conference, the Save A Life Foundation (SALF) will be holding a press conference regarding SALF’s role in the states “homeland security” plans. Lt. Gov Corinne Wood will be making a statement, voicing her support along with Illinois Municipal League Ex. Dir., Ken Alderson. Community leaders from across the state are welcomed to share their ideas regarding “Emergency Preparedness” training at the local level. As you know, SALF is responsible for passing legislation mandating that all police and fire personnel be trained in First aid and CPR upon graduation. To date SALF is also responsible for training over 400,000 Illinois children and adults, the basic life-supporting skills. When: Friday, December 14, 2001, at 10:00 a.m. Where: Chicago Hilton, 720 S. Michigan Ave Notables attending the press conference, include:
